After his UFC debut way back in 2013, Conor McGregor has gone onto become one of the faces of the fight game. However since losing twice in succession to Dustin Poirier, most recently at UFC 264. Conor has had to deal with a wave of criticism from UFC fans, journalists and experts alike. This documentary will analyse the reasons that contributed to his demise and predict if his days really are numbered at the top of the fight game. This is Conor McGregor: Not The Same Animal.

Yes I do agree I think he was the best in the featherweight division at the time. His coach did state in a recent interview that the reason he moved up in weight was that the weight cuts were torture to get through. With Conor becoming a PPV star and no longer trying to get noticed he felt this is something he should no longer have to put his body through.
